For people who lived in small African villages that were part of larger kingdoms,
where were major problems resolved?

Answer: Major problems or disputes were settled by the chief.

Explanation: Every village had a subchief who had a palace that served as a tribunal for hearing cases. Cases were judged and both sides were heard before judgment was pronounced.
